The clutch control servo valve is a precise electronic control component, whose main function is to control the clutch by precisely controlling the hydraulic pressure. In racing cars, the clutch control servo valve can ensure a smooth transition during gear shifting, avoid shocks during the shifting process, improve the driver's experience, and at the same time ensure the power transmission efficiency of the racing car.

In the racing sport, the clutch plays a crucial role, connecting the engine and the transmission system and realizing the power transmission of the vehicle through the control of the engagement and disengagement of the clutch. The control algorithm and feedback mechanism of the Mugen clutch control servo valve can monitor the working state of the clutch in real time and accurately control the engagement and disengagement of the clutch according to actual needs. During the engagement process, the servo valve can quickly transmit hydraulic pressure to the clutch, allowing it to achieve complete engagement in a short time, thus realizing the rapid transmission of power; during the disengagement process, the servo valve can quickly release the hydraulic pressure, allowing the clutch to achieve complete disengagement in a short time, thus realizing the rapid interruption of power. In this way, the Mugen clutch control servo valve can ensure that the power output of the vehicle is smoother and more stable during the start, acceleration, gear shifting, and other processes, and can also quickly disengage the clutch during emergency braking to avoid overloading of the transmission system, improving the safety performance of the vehicle.
